Westcountry Marine goes west

Boat sales and brokerage company, Westcountry Marine has gone into voluntary liquidation after building up losses of around £410,000, writes Katina Read.

The company, which operated from the Queen Anne Battery in Plymouth, ceased trading in April after starting to experience difficulties during 2006.

The firm was established in 2003 and held dealerships for several boatbuilders and developed a range of new and used power and sail boats. Increased marketing costs and cash flow problems have contributed to the difficulties.

Ian Walker, partner at insolvency and business recovery specialist firm, Begbies Traynor, has been appointed liquidator.
